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ll arrive at your property, assess the situation, and develop a customized plan to extract the water, dry the area, and prevent further damage. Our team will identify the source of the leak or flood and take steps to prevent it from happening again.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use state-of-the-art equipment to extract as much water as possible from your property. Our technicians will work quickly and efficiently to reduce the damage and get your property back to normal.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ry your property and prevent further moisture buildup. Our team will work to dry the affected area, including walls, floors, and ceilings, to prevent mold and mildew growth.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your property to prevent the spread of bacteria and other microorganisms. Our team will use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to ensure your property is safe and healthy.
Step 5: Restoration and Repairs
Our team will work with you to restore your property to its original condition. We’ll make any necessary repairs, including replacing drywall, flooring, and other damaged materials.

After Hours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a single room | Yes | No | DIY can be effective for small, contained leaks. |
| Large flood in multiple rooms | No | Yes | Large floods need specialized equipment and expertise to extract water and dry the area. |
| Water damage from a burst pipe | No | Yes | Burst pipes need immediate attention to prevent further damage and safety hazards. |
| Musty odors or mold growth | No | Yes | Musty odors and mold growth need professional equipment and expertise to remove safely and effectively. |
| Warped or buckled flooring | No | Yes |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of underlying water damage, which needs professional attention to repair. |
| Visible water damage or leaks | No | Yes | Visible water damage or leaks need immediate attention to prevent further damage and safety hazards. |

After Hours Water Removal Cost in Ennis, TX
The cost of After Hours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Ennis, TX. These estimates are based on typical prices for this service and should not be considered a guarantee.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Restoration and Repairs |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ials needed |
| Emergency Service Call | $100 – $500 | Time of day, day of the week, and location |
| Free On-Site Assessment | $0 – $200 | Distance from our location, time of day, and complexity of the job |
